  • Nimbin Drug Capital of Australia? or A Quiet Country Village? It would be helpful to have previously visited Nimbin in the past 20 years or so, to get a better perspective, but, having visited many towns with a slightly similar counterculture, the findings are to me, obvious.
    In this video, I attempt to camp at the local showgrounds and get a feel for the town. Is it still a semi-out-of-control drug hang out or is there more to offer.
    Nestled in the lush, rolling hills of New South Wales, Australia, Nimbin holds a unique place in the country's cultural landscape. Well known for its bohemian spirit, vibrant art scene, and enduring countercultural identity, it has become a symbol of Australia's alternative lifestyle.
    With a trip out to Tania Creek Protestors Falls, the real essence of the struggle to keep their local rainforest became apparent. What a great story. And, yes, Nimbin has grown up to be a delightful country village with its own independence and well worth a visit.

    Nice one! I love that part of Oz and have many friends in the area. Also great reporting on Terania. Maybe you'd be interested in doing an episode in the Daintree-Bloomfield area, which had similar action a few years later in the blockade to stop a road being built through the Daintree forest. It ended up going through but the massive attention and support for the protest helped achieve World Heritage protection of the area.
